Pros of Independent Travel
Embarking on a solo adventure can boost various aspects of your life. Here are some persuasive reasons why solo travel should be on your radar:
- 1. Freedom to Explore: When you travel alone, you have the autonomy to plan your itinerary without any compromises.
- 2. Growth Opportunities: Solo travel pushes you out of your comfort zone, fostering personal growth and self-awareness.
- 3. Deep Cultural Connections: Without the presence of companions, you are more likely to interact with locals and immerse yourself in the way of life.
- 4. Embracing Spontaneity: Solo travel allows you to be flexible and make impromptu decisions based on your mood.
Vital Tips for a Enjoyable Solo Journey
Before you set off on your solo adventure, consider these crucial tips to ensure a pleasant and rewarding experience:
- 1. Do Your Destination Homework: Prior research about the destination can help you understand the culture and plan your trip effectively.
- 2. Stay in Contact: Share your itinerary with family or friends and stay connected through regular updates or check-ins.
- 3. Pack Light: Packing essentials only can streamline your travel and give you more flexibility to move around.
- 4. Listen to Your Intuition: If a situation feels unsafe, trust your instincts and act accordingly.
- 5. Pick Up Essential Language: Knowing a few basic phrases can improve communication and show respect for the culture.
